Week 11 AUS Football Players of the Week: Roseway, Tshiamala and Hughes honoured

Offensive Player of the Week

Name: Randy Roseway
University: St. Francis Xavier University
Position: Wide receiver
Hometown: Ottawa, Ont.
Year of eligibility: Fifth
Academic program: BA
Height and weight: 6'0", 170lbs

Wide receiver Randy Roseway of the St. Francis Xavier X-Men is the Atlantic University Sport football offensive player of the week for the week ending Nov. 22, 2015.

A fifth-year arts student from Ottawa, Ont., Roseway had five catches for 61 yards in Saturday's 36-9 loss in the CIS Uteck Bowl to UBC.

He led all StFX receivers in the game and averaged 12.2 yards per catch. On special teams he also had three punt returns for 21 yards.


Defensive Player of the Week
Name:
Daniel Tshiamala
University: St. Francis Xavier University
Position: Linebacker
Hometown: Kinshasa, Congo
Year of eligibility: Third
Academic program: BA
Height and weight: 6'1, 235lbs

Linebacker Daniel Tshiamala of the St. Francis Xavier X-Men is the Atlantic University Sport football defensive player of the week.

A third-year arts student from Kinshasa, Congo, Tshiamala had 6.5 tackles (four solo and five assisted) in the X-Men's 36-9 loss to UBC in Saturday's CIS Uteck Bowl.

These included a tackle for a loss of one yard. Tshiamala also forced a fumble, recovered a fumble and had an interception which he returned for 18 yards.

Special Teams Player of the Week
Name:
Keon Hughes
University: St. Francis Xavier University
Position: Wide receiver
Hometown: Mississauga, Ont.
Year of eligibility: Third
Academic program: BA
Height and weight: 6'3", 220lbs

Wide receiver Keon Hughes of the St. Francis Xavier X-Men is the Atlantic University Sport football special teams player of the week for the week.

A third-year arts student from Mississauga, Ont., Hughes played a strong game blocking and tackling for the X-Men on special teams coverage in their 36-9 loss to UBC in Saturday's CIS Uteck Bowl.

He recovered a UBC onside kick attempt and also contributed on offence with four catches for 34 yards.
